Ordinals
beta
Sat 2166239396514263
decimal
73689.10596514263
percentile
4.3324787930285265%
name
lzuyeezmpfiw
cycle
0
epoch
2
block
73689
offset
10596514263
timestamp
2024-03-28 21:05:16 UTC
rarity
common
prev
next